什么是区块链?
区块链是一种分布式账本技术,通过将交易记录按照时间顺序链接起来形成一个不可篡改的区块,从而实现去中心化的共识机制。每个区块都包含了前一个区块的哈希值,确保了数据的一致性和安全性。区块链的特点包括去中心化、可追溯性、匿名性和不可篡改性。
区块链有哪些应用?
区块链技术在金融领域最为知名,可用于数字货币的发行和交易。比特币是最早的区块链应用之一,它使用了区块链来实现去中心化的电子货币系统。除此之外,区块链还可以应用于供应链管理、智能合约、数字身份验证、知识产权保护等领域。
区块链的工作原理是什么?
区块链的工作原理主要包括分布式共识机制和密码学算法。分布式共识机制使得多个节点达成一致,确保了区块链中交易记录的可信度。而密码学算法保证了数据的安全性,通过哈希函数和数字签名等技术,保障了交易的不可篡改性和用户的匿名性。
区块链的优势有哪些?
区块链具有去中心化、透明度、安全性和高效性等优势。去中心化使得没有中心机构控制数据,降低了信任成本;透明度使得所有的交易记录对所有人可见,提高了交易的可信度;安全性通过密码学算法保证了数据的安全性和不可篡改性;高效性通过分布式共识算法实现了快速的交易确认和结算。
区块链面临的挑战有哪些?
区块链面临着可扩展性、隐私保护、合规性和技术发展等挑战。目前的区块链技术还存在着交易速度较慢和能源消耗较高等问题,需要进一步的技术创新来解决。同时,区块链的匿名性也带来了一些隐私保护的问题,需要在隐私和透明度之间进行权衡。此外,区块链的合规性和法律监管也是一个亟待解决的问题,各国政府和监管机构需要制定相应的规章制度来规范区块链的发展和应用。